We give a simple proof characterizing the complexity of Pres-burger arithmetic augmented with additional predicates. We show that Pres-burger arithmetic with additional predicates is 1 1 complete. Adding one unary predicate is enough to get 1 1 hardness, while adding more predicates (of any arity) does not make the complexity any worse.

This paper proposes the cascading of two algorithms that combines the features of both PDLZW and Arithmetic coding and also compares this with deflate which is a cascading of LZ77 and Huffman Coding. In PDLZW algorithm, the dictionary is divided into several dictionaries based on the size of the words. With the hierarchical parallel dictionary set, the search time can be reduced significantly. ...

We present below our first implementation results on a modular arithmetic library for cryptography on GPUs. Our library, in C++ for CUDA, provides modular arithmetic, finite field arithmetic and some ECC support. Several algorithms and memory coding styles have been compared: local, shared and register. For moderate sizes, we report up to 2.6 speedup compared to state-of-the-art library.
